Community Meeting for Village of St. Louis Set for June 26

Posted on June 6, 2023 at 10:42 AM by Nancy McCormick

Loudoun County will host a community meeting for the Village of St. Louis Monday, June 26, 2023, at 6:30 p.m. at Banneker Elementary School, 35231 Snake Hill Road, Middleburg. Residents are encouraged to attend to learn about the results of the community survey conducted earlier this year, including updates on initiatives that require action as identified through the community survey, as well as the status of the St. Louis Village Plan. Members of the St. Louis Village Plan Task Force and representatives of Loudoun County are scheduled to be present at the meeting.

The St. Louis Village Plan, which was initiated by the Board of Supervisors in 2022, is intended to help St. Louis maintain its unique character, support the community’s goals and address a range of issues related to land use, development and quality of life.

Following a community meeting in January, St. Louis residents were asked to provide feedback on three focus areas identified by the St. Louis Village Plan Task Force: History and Heritage; Land Use, Development, and Infrastructure; and Water.

Community Meeting for Village of St. Louis Set for January 31

Posted on January 30, 2023 at 11:19 AM by Nancy McCormick

Loudoun County will host a community meeting for the Village of St. Louis Tuesday, January 31, 2023, at 6:30 p.m. at Banneker Elementary School, 35231 Snake Hill Road, Middleburg. Residents are encouraged to attend to learn about the status of the St. Louis Village Plan and to provide feedback to members of the St. Louis Village Plan Task Force and representatives of Loudoun County.

The St. Louis Village Plan, which was initiated by the Board of Supervisors in 2022, is intended to help St. Louis maintain its unique character, support the community’s goals and address a range of issues related to land use, development and quality of life.

In addition to an update on the village plan, residents will receive information about an opportunity for free well water testing and a potential community water feasibility study in the future.
